Direct and Indirect Speech

Direct Speech:

  • In direct speech, we use the exact same words to quote someone.
  • Inverting commas are used to enclose the words.
  • For example, He said, "I am going to London."

Indirect Speech:

  • The style we use when we choose different words to report what someone said is known as Indirect Speech.
  • Inverting commas is not used in Indirect Speech.
  • The word "That" is used as a conjunction.
  • The present tense is changed into Past Tense.
  • For example, He said that he was going to London.
